Ayatollah

In the intricate tapestry of Islamic theology, the role of the Ayatollah within Shia Islam stands as a significant and multifaceted entity. The illustrious title “Ayatollah,” which translates to “Sign of God,” is revered among Shia Muslims and carries with it immense scholarly prestige, spiritual authority, and communal respect.
